如何比对两个excel表的身份证号码和姓名

如题所述

当需要比较两个Excel表格中的身份证号码和姓名时,可以使用Excel的VLOOKUP函数来实现高效的数据匹配。首先,确保你的数据已经整理好,例如在第一个工作簿"book1.xlsx"的"sheet1"工作表中,身份证号码存储在A列,姓名在B列。接下来,你可以按照以下步骤操作:

1. 打开第二个工作簿"C1",选择你要插入匹配结果的单元格(比如A2),然后输入VLOOKUP函数。函数的基本格式如下:`=VLOOKUP(要查找的值, 数据范围, 要返回的列的索引号, [是否近似匹配])`。

2. 将"要查找的值"替换为你的第一个工作簿中对应身份证号码的单元格引用,比如"a1"。"数据范围"则填写源文件的范围,即"[book1.xlsx]sheet1!a:b",表示A1:B1的范围。

3. "要返回的列的索引号"是2,因为身份证号码在A列,姓名在B列,B列的索引是从1开始的,所以是2。如果你想匹配的是姓名,这个数字则改为1。

4. 如果你想精确匹配,可以将第四个参数设置为`FALSE`,默认情况下,VLOOKUP会进行近似匹配,如果数值不完全匹配,可能会返回错误。如果确保数据无误,可以忽略这个参数或设置为`FALSE`。

5. 将公式拖动到你需要匹配的单元格区域,如果身份证号码在源表中存在,VLOOKUP会返回相应的姓名;如果不存在,单元格将显示#NA错误。

通过这种方式,你可以快速、准确地在两个Excel表格中比对身份证号码和姓名信息。记得检查数据格式的一致性,以确保VLOOKUP的正确执行。
温馨提示:答案为网友推荐,仅供参考
相似回答